The 15 MVA 33/11 kV and 33/6.6 kV On-Load Tap Changer Transformer (OLTC Transformer) is a medium-capacity power transformer designed for utility substations, industrial power distribution systems, and renewable energy plants.
This oil-immersed power transformer steps down 33 kV medium voltage to 11 kV or 6.6 kV distribution voltage, ensuring stable electricity supply for factories, infrastructure, and grid networks.
With an integrated on-load tap changer, the transformer can automatically regulate voltage under load conditions, maintaining stable output voltage even when grid load changes.
This makes it a reliable solution for modern power distribution networks that require high efficiency, low losses, and long-term operational stability.
Typical parameters for a 15 MVA OLTC transformer are shown below.
| Parameter | Specification |
|---|---|
| Rated Power | 15 MVA Power Transformer |
| Transformer Type | Oil Immersed Transformer |
| Primary Voltage | 33 kV Transformer |
| Secondary Voltage | 11 kV / 6.6 kV Distribution Transformer |
| Phase | Three Phase Transformer |
| Frequency | 50 / 60 Hz |
| Vector Group | Dyn11 / YNd11 |
| Cooling Method | ONAN / ONAF |
| Tap Changer | On-Load Tap Changer (OLTC) |
| Tap Range | ±10% |
| Tap Step | 1.25% |
| Impedance | 8 – 12% |
| Insulation Level | IEC Standard |
| Standards | IEC 60076 Power Transformer |
Technical specifications can be custom designed according to project requirements.
The integrated OLTC transformer system enables automatic voltage adjustment without interrupting power supply.
This function is essential for industrial substations and utility transformers, where voltage stability directly affects equipment performance and grid reliability.
The transformer core uses high-grade CRGO silicon steel, reducing both no-load loss and load loss.
Benefits include:
Higher transformer efficiency
Reduced operating cost
Improved power system stability
This design makes the transformer suitable for continuous operation in power distribution networks.
The transformer adopts a robust insulation structure consisting of:
Transformer insulation oil
Electrical insulation paper
Pressboard insulation components
This ensures high dielectric strength and reliable operation under high-voltage power system conditions.
The transformer uses standard cooling configurations:
ONAN – Oil Natural Air Natural
Suitable for normal load operation.
ONAF – Oil Natural Air Forced
Provides enhanced cooling for higher load conditions.
The cooling system ensures stable thermal performance and long transformer life.
The transformer tank is designed for outdoor substation installation and long-term operation.
Standard protection devices include:
Buchholz relay protection
Oil level indicator
Winding temperature indicator
Pressure relief device
Silica gel breather
These components ensure safe operation of the medium voltage transformer.
